It's the age old story of "you can shear the sheep many times..you can only eat them once." Nothing aggravates novice visitors to the VIs as much as taxi fees/ service.
Learned a couple decades ago that St. John Cabs would pretend they could not hear the request from Ms Lucy's in coral bay.
Took a ride on St. Thomas in the "load em up taxi" several years ago in which I thought the driver was going to assult a passenger who did not know how to tell him how to get to the small rental while we were on the way to redhook. When it was straightened out..the host was there to greet the single lady traveler and the driver began anew the screaming and cursing at the traveler and the landlord. I've paid 180 bucks for a round trip wih 5 people from Sopers to CGB...I've paid 85$ for a horrific ride from Leverick North Sound to VGYH chandlery to pick up a part, 5 minutes from lot to store, get part, back to lot...to be left there 2 hrs while the driver obviously took other fares. Both ways ghe seemed determined to imitate a roller coaster ride in the back of that pickup. Wasting most of three hours to get a part, I did not need a near death experience going and coming.
I've paid 95$ to miss the ferry from STT to CA..and driver actually told me he wasn't going to charge me more to go across the street to the Windward Passage.
A friend staying at our place on VG wanted to go to the full moon party at Trellis with her two young children..so checked into the tamarind club ..got taxi, paid for a round trip when dropped off (a mistake but honesty should matter) , asked that he return in two hours..he gave them a card...never came back..did not answer phone.
Let it be said, there have been many other pleasant and average experiences over the years as well. Never a single time being taken advantage of from VGYH to condo...a couple times had to get a guest to Leverick for first north sound ferry ..taxi picked up at o dark thirty as agreed..no problem.
But it is a fact that taxis are way over priced by North American standards and it does indeed make a bad impression for visitors. With Cuba opening up providing likely cheaper and less costly access..not sure it's a great time to tax and taxi cost visitors to the BVI to death. As I understand it, in both the BVI and USVI taxi drivers hold a lot of political sway. Unfortunately they may have a big hand in killing the golden goose.
